Six weeks after COVID-19 shuttered Stephen Colbert’s “The Late Show,” the show is again sidelined as the host recovers from a burst appendix. The comedian revealed on social media Monday that he’s recovering after surgery, wiping out planned shows for Tuesday, Wednesday and Thursday. “Going forward, all emails to my appendix will be handled by my pancreas,” the former Second City actor joked.
